Top 20 NuGet functional Packages

Yet another implementation of an option/optional type for .NET. An Optional type explicitly represents the type of a value that may or may not exist. While you can do this with nulls, that has many drawbacks. Some of the benefits of this library over some others include comprehensive equality supp...
DiscriminatedUnion AutoMap Helper.
Immutable persistent collections, algebraic sum-type aka descriminated union, Ref type and supportive extensions for performant functional programming in C#. Split from the DryIoc: https://github.com/dadhi/DryIoc
A simple and easy to use option type for C#.
Rabbit link astral markup to service schema
Rabbit link astral contracts implementation
Types and parsers for working with the HTTP State (Cookies) specification in RFC 6265
Testing utilities and helpers for Freya libraries, plus Freya applications
Testing utilities and helpers for Freya libraries, plus Freya applications
Polyfill for Kestrel based server implementations
Polyfill for Kestrel based server implementations
Freya Optics for access to HTTP state/cookies extension properties of requests and responses
Freya Optics for access to HTTP state/cookies extension properties of requests and responses
Freya Optics for access to Patch extension properties of requests and responses
Freya Optics for access to core HTTP properties of requests and responses
Freya Optics for access to CORS extension properties of requests and responses
A Freya machine expressing the core HTTP semantics and logic
Core utilities and tools for building Freya machines
Batteries-included Freya Stack